Hosted by the Heart Foundation and using expert trainers from Heart of the Nation, these free information sessions aim to increase awareness about what is a cardiac arrest and provide education on how to respond effectively in real life situations with two crucial skills - CPR and the use of a defibrillator.

We want to increase community confidence to ensure that individuals become active first responders in these life threatening emergencies. The knowledge and skills you will gain could help save a life!
